在Angular中,可以使用插值表达式或属性绑定来动态设置HTML元素的id名称。
- 使用插值表达式:
在HTML中,可以使用双大括号{{}}将动态的id名称嵌入到元素的属性中。例如:
- 使用插值表达式:
在HTML中,可以使用双大括号{{}}将动态的id名称嵌入到元素的属性中。例如:
- 在组件的类中,定义一个变量dynamicId,并给它赋予一个动态的值。例如:
- 在组件的类中,定义一个变量dynamicId,并给它赋予一个动态的值。例如:
- 这样,当组件渲染时,动态id名称将被替换为myDynamicId。
- 使用属性绑定:
在HTML中,可以使用方括号[]将动态的id名称绑定到元素的属性中。例如:
- 使用属性绑定:
在HTML中,可以使用方括号[]将动态的id名称绑定到元素的属性中。例如:
- 在组件的类中,同样定义一个变量dynamicId,并给它赋予一个动态的值。例如:
- 在组件的类中,同样定义一个变量dynamicId,并给它赋予一个动态的值。例如:
- 这样,当组件渲染时,动态id名称将被替换为myDynamicId。
以上两种方法都可以根据组件中的变量值来动态设置HTML元素的id名称。在实际应用中,可以根据具体的业务需求来确定动态id的命名规则和值。